unalias命令手册
unalias:取消命令别名
功能描述
unalias命令用来取消命令别名,是 shell 内建命令。如果需要取消任意一个命令别名,则使用该命令别名作为指令的参数选项即可。如果使用-a选项,则表示取消所有已经存在的命令别名。
命令语法
unalias [选项] [别名]
常用选项
选项 | 含义 |
---|---|
-a | 取消全部已定义的别名 |
参考实例
(1)取消一个别名
// 先设置一个别名
[root@cnLinuxer ~]# alias ok='pwd'
[root@cnLinuxer ~]# ok
/root
// 取消定义的别名ok
[root@cnLinuxer ~]# unalias ok
[root@cnLinuxer ~]# ok
-bash: ok: 未找到命令
(2)取消全部已定义的别名
[root@cnLinuxer ~]# unalias -a
注意
(1)执行脚本时请注意:
使用source命令执行的bash脚本如果执行了alias或unalias命令,那么有可能会对终端环境的别名设置产生影响;终端环境的别名设置也可能改变运行结果;
通过sh方式调用的bash脚本或直接运行当前用户有执行权限的脚本不受终端环境的别名影响。
(2)查看及设置别名,请使用alias命令。
有收获,点个在看
评论